Mary Alice Hoban


Mary Alice Hoban, 88, of Pittston, passed away Wednesday, May 2, 2018 in Wilkes-Barre General Hospital. Born in Laflin on August 25, 1929, she was the daughter of the late Robert P. and Mary Delores Devlin Oliver.

She was a graduate of West Pittston High School and worked in the local garment industry.

Mary Alice was a member of the ILGWU and Our Lady of the Eucharist Parish, Pittston.

She was an avid reader. She was a loving mother, grandmother, great-grandmother and will be truly missed by family and friends.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her son Michael Hoban; son-in-law George Carey; brothers James, John and Thomas Oliver; sisters Ann Marie Lynn and Catherine Dugan.

Surviving are son Robert Hoban and his wife Patricia, Scranton; daughters Mary Theresa Carey, Pittston; Patricia Nemeth and her husband Stephen, Avoca; Paula McDonough, Jenkins Township; Maureen Kosik and her husband Michael, Endicott, NY; 13 grandchildren; 14 great-grandchildren; sister, Helene Hoffman, West Chester; numerous nieces and nephews.
